Transaction 43832310fc4aee69768fe8dff79abb0d9903dc757bcede73afa280dbe723778b
1 Input
2 Outputs
- 43832310fc4aee69768fe8dff79abb0d9903dc757bcede73afa280dbe723778b:0
- 43832310fc4aee69768fe8dff79abb0d9903dc757bcede73afa280dbe723778b:1
value 10000000
address 3LhJU2m1kuLQaRZE2ANZ5xrG4kGhnmUKad
value 15993220
address 1DfTEREUCYXirjPLmZ4KT7Py3gzS17yJnX